CANCELLATION AND CHANGES. Client and Caterer understand that circumstances, <br />including those beyond the control of either may happen. In such matters, the following shall control: <br />A. Cancellation or Reschedule after Initial Deposit-Save the Date but Before Final Payment. <br />If the event is canceled for any reason after the Initial Deposit has been made, but before the Final <br />Payment has been made, Caterer shall be entitled to retain the Initial Deposit as earned and this <br />Contract shall be terminated without further obligation owed by one party to the other. If the event <br />needs to be rescheduled, Caterer and Client shall work in good faith to change the Saved Date, in <br />which case, this Contract shall be modified but not terminated. If a new Saved Date cannot be <br />determined, this Contract shall be terminated without further obligation owed by one party to the <br />other. <br />B. Cancellation after Final Payment. If the event is canceled for any reason after the Final Payment <br />has been made, the Caterer shall be entitled to retain one hundred percent (100%) of the total <br />compensation received. Caterer shall remit the food and beverage in un-prepared or uncooked form <br />to Client if food and beverage have been ordered. <br />C. Change in Headcount.In those cases where the headcount changes after the Final Payment has <br />been made, Caterer will use its best efforts to accommodate the change. Caterers shall be entitled to <br />a guaranteed minimum equal to seventy percent (70%) of the headcount as determined and <br />memorialized with the Final Payment.
